Zero hero

Postby Mr.Chaos » 07 Mar 2009, 19:47

60 Total Cards

24 Creatures
-------------
4x Crimson Kobolds
4x Crookshank Kobolds
4x Kobolds of Kher Keep
4x Ornithopter
4x Phyrexian Walker
4x Shield Sphere

24 Spells
----------
4x Gaea's Anthem
4x Glorious Anthem
4x Howling Mine
4x Mox Emerald
4x Mox Pearl
4x Oblivion Ring

12 Land
--------
4x Plains
4x Savannah
4x Treetop Village

Wacky, weird, nuts and a few bolts. That is this deck.
Don't take it serious. The only reason it is here is because it flushed out a bug with Cateran Overlord when the computer played that card. (see page 24 of the "known bugs thread on the main page)

Anyway, throw the free crittes in play, hope for a starting hand with a land and a mox and start singing the anthem. :lol:
The amazing thing is, it can actually win! Well, sometimes, if it gets lucky. :roll:

I thought about Kher Keep, but that meant adding a 3rd color and with the anthems needing 1ww or 2gg, adding a 3rd color would make casting them harder and you really, really, really need them.
So no keep for me. Well... ok, maybe I will try it once. :wink:
